drupal_render_children

7 common.inc drupal_render_children(&$element, $children_keys = NULL)
8 common.inc drupal_render_children(&$element, $children_keys = NULL)

Renders children of an element and concatenates them.

This renders all children of an element using drupal_render() and then joins them together into a single string.

Parameters

$element: The structured array whose children shall be rendered.

$children_keys: If the keys of the element's children are already known, they can be passed in to save another run of element_children().

Code

function drupal_render_children(&$element, $children_keys = NULL) {
  if ($children_keys === NULL) {
    $children_keys = element_children($element);
  }
  $output = '';
  foreach ($children_keys as $key) {
    if (!empty($element[$key])) {
      $output .= drupal_render($element[$key]);
    }
  }
  return $output;
}
